Skip to content
View albertus82's full-sized avatar

Block or report albertus82

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
albertus82/README.md

albertus82 avatar

Hi, I'm albertus82 πŸ‘‹

Passionate developer, technology enthusiast, and creator of practical tools for real-world needs.
Exploring everything from vintage hardware to modern web apps.
GitHub


πŸš€ About Me

  • Versatile Developer: Focused on building desktop applications, utilities, and libraries, mainly in Java and related technologies.
  • Hacker at Heart: Interested in seismology, vintage computers (Commodore, GW-BASIC/QBasic), Raspberry Pi, file and data storage, and more.
  • Open Source Advocate: Most projects are open and built for the community, with a strong emphasis on Linux/macOS/Windows cross-compatibility.

πŸ› οΈ Technologies & Languages

  • Languages: Java, BASIC (GW-BASIC, QBasic), Inno Setup Script
  • Frameworks & Libraries: SWT, JFace, Maven, Tika, MQTT, JDBC
  • Platforms: Linux, Windows, macOS, Raspberry Pi
  • Topics & Skills: Seismology apps, file encoding/decoding, file storage (RDBMS, compressed/encrypted), extension/file renaming utilities, system monitoring

πŸ“š Highlighted Projects

  • earthquake-bulletin
    A cross-platform desktop client for the GEOFON Program GFZ Potsdam Earthquake Bulletin.
    Java, SWT, JFace, Seismology, Linux, macOS, Windows, GPL-3.0

  • acodec
    GUI encoder/decoder for algorithms with hashing support.
    Java, Application, Codec, Hashing, SWT, GPL-3.0

  • jface-utils
    Utility library: Preferences Framework, HTTP Server, MQTT, macOS support.
    Java, JFace, MQTT, macOS, LGPL-3.0

  • relatable-storage
    Java library for RDBMS-based file storage with compression and encryption.
    Java, RDBMS, Maven, MIT

  • raspberrypi-cpu-logger
    Send Raspberry Pi CPU frequency and temperature to ThingSpeak.
    Java, Raspberry Pi, CPU Monitoring, MIT

  • extfix
    File Extension Fix Tool - find and rename files with wrong extensions.
    Java, File Management, MIT

  • commodore
    Projects related to Commodore computers.
    Java, Retro Computing

  • vbesvga-oemsetup
    OEM setup INF generator for vbesvga.drv (GW-BASIC/QBasic).
    GW-BASIC, QBasic, Retro


πŸ“Š GitHub Stats

albertus82's GitHub stats albertus82's top languages


🌐 More

  • πŸ’‘ Always exploring new technologies and sharing with the community.
  • πŸ” Check out all my repositories on my GitHub profile.
  • πŸ“ Note: This profile highlights only some of my work. I have 38 repositories in total. For the full list, see all my repositories.

Let's build something amazing together!

Pinned Loading

  1. jface-utils jface-utils Public

    Java SWT/JFace Utility Library including a Preferences Framework, Lightweight HTTP Server and macOS support.

    Java 10 2

  2. acodec acodec Public

    Encoder & decoder for various algorithms with graphical user interface.

    Java 7

  3. earthquake-bulletin earthquake-bulletin Public

    A desktop client for GEOFON Program GFZ Potsdam Earthquake Bulletin.

    Java 7

  4. cyclesmod cyclesmod Public

    A mod for "The Cycles: International Grand Prix Racing" (1989) and "Grand Prix Circuit" (1988).

    Java 8

  5. jar-classes-version-detector jar-classes-version-detector Public

    Easily find out which version of JRE is required by a JAR/WAR/EAR.

    Python 1

  6. update-wget-hsts update-wget-hsts Public

    Import preloaded HTTP Strict Transport Security (HSTS) domains into GNU Wget.

    Java 3